I wouldn't be surprised if the issue with releasing the source code of CNC games is that there is proprietary code inside them. I know that is the issue with the later CNCs; you can't even properly add new music in RA3 because the code behind that is proprietary.

It happened with DOOM for DOS/Windows; Id used a proprietary sound system and because of that, had to release the Linux source code to the game. (which fans had to subsequently port back to DOS)

(although Id learned their lesson...)
